Each month the North End/Waterfront Residents’ Association Clean Streets Committee recognizes a local business or resident as a Good Neighbor for continuously cleaning the sidewalk and curb in front of their place of business or dwelling.
Michele Tirella has been selected to receive the October 2011 award for her daily cleaning on several streets in the community.
Michele is the first non-business owner to be presented the Committee’s Good Neighbor Award for helping to keep the North End community clean.
Michele was nominated at a NEWRA Clean Streets monthly meeting and the members voted her to receive the Good Neighbor Award by a wide margin.
